Now, before we get into the fundamentals of how you can watch 'Little Women' right now, here are some details about the RKO Radio Pictures family flick.
Released November 16th, 1933, 'Little Women' stars Katharine Hepburn, Joan Bennett, Paul Lukas, Edna May Oliver The NR mov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 55 min, and received a user score of 67 (out of 100) on TMDb, which put together reviews from 122 well-known users.
Interested in knowing what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"Little Women is a coming-of-age drama tracing the lives of four sisters: Meg, Jo, Beth and Amy. During the American Civil War, the girls father is away serving as a minister to the troops. The family, headed by their beloved Marmee, must struggle to make ends meet, with the help of their kind and wealthy neighbor, Mr. Laurence, and his high spirited grandson Laurie."
